Sylvester Stallone and Lynda Carter in a single frame
‘Rocky Balboa’ and ‘Wonder Woman’, both are strong characters, who are inspirational to men and women worldwide. ‘Rocky’ tells the story of an underdog boxer, Rocky Balboa. He rose to fame and became the champion, with his hard work, dedication, and determination.
On the other hand, ‘Wonder Woman’ is a fictional character, a female superhero from the DC universe and she represents female power. Wonder Woman first appeared in DC comics in 1941 and Lynd Carter was the first woman to play the fictional character on the big screen.

Sylvester Stallone wanted to give Inked tribute to Wonder Woman
Sylvester Stallone once wanted to give an inked tribute or tattoo to Lynda Carter or Wonder Woman. As Stallone was going through a rough patch in his relationship with his wife Jennifer Flavin last year, he wanted to alter her tattoo, and cover it with that of Lynda Carter. Eventually, he replaced the tattoo with Butkus his dog.
